Italy’s current account surplus climbs to €5.14 billion in April

The Bank of Italy released its current account data on Friday. Italy's current account surplus climbed to €5.14 billion in April from €2.85 billion in April last year.

The goods trade surplus increased to €6.04 billion in April from €4.20 billion in April last year. The services trade balance rose to a surplus of €108 million from a deficit of €2 million.

The capital account deficit increased to €127 million in April from €13 million last year, while the financial account balance surplus jumped to €7.07 billion from €3.07 billion.
